Transaction edf93baf515ca1b536ce71e6b7f2991b0c56766a432675d1925a2d33fcee489e
1 Input
1 Output
-
edf93baf515ca1b536ce71e6b7f2991b0c56766a432675d1925a2d33fcee489e:0
- value
- 76827
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e296be2155bcb4f5b73c57d7986b5681b8bc6d42 OP_EQUAL
- address
- 3NM7DgboLd8qZUqd3gfwikDQRQaatU5WnJ